新闻中心

EEPW首页>嵌入式系统>设计应用> MSP430F5529 番外(三)一些问题解答及中断系统说明

MSP430F5529 番外(三)一些问题解答及中断系统说明

作者: 时间:2016-11-28 来源:网络 收藏
(1)CCSV5中变量长度。
不同的芯片或者不同的编译环境下,变量长度的定义也是不同的。一般情况下,大家对变量长度也都不是很在意。但是,在做测量或者节约内存的时候,就有必要了,否则很可能造成变量溢出或者浪费空间。下表给出常用的几个变量类型的长度:默认值请看下表:

(2)大家新建工程的时候,有时候会在工程里面一个个添加很多头文件以及相应的源文件。如液晶显示头文件HAL_Dogs102x6.h,这个头文件很坑爹,想要用它,那么就不得不一个个添加十几个相关联的文件。于是,问题就来了,但你头文件添加太多的时候,编译很可能就会报错:“ program will not fit into”,意思大概就是内存不够。内存一般来说不会不够用的。问题可能在于:添加头文件的时候没有设置路径:

或者最简便的方法就是:把官方的LAB例程中的主函数换成你的,其余不变,这样会很方便(不用一个个添加头文件了)。可能依然会出现上述问题,这时候只需要换一个不同编号(1-7)的LAB文件再“偷天换日”就可以了。

上一页 1 2 下一页

关键词:MSP430F5529中断系

评论


技术专区

关闭